Sibyl AI and Surge AI serve completely different needs. Sibyl AI offers a unique niche for spiritual seekers with personalized metaphysical insights and creative tools, while Surge AI is an enterprise-grade platform for AI labs needing expert human feedback and advanced benchmarks. Choose Sibyl if you want esoteric guidance; choose Surge if you need rigorous RLHF and red teaming for frontier models.

Who should pick which

  • Spiritual seeker exploring esoteric traditions
    Pick: Sibyl AI

    Sibyl offers uniquely tailored tools like dream interpretation, Ennealogy, and etymology decoding for personal metaphysical growth.

  • AI safety red teaming team
    Pick: Surge AI

    Surge provides domain-expert human feedback, red teaming, and rigorous benchmarks like Antidote and Riemann-bench to expose model weaknesses.

  • Creative writer needing inspiration
    Pick: Sibyl AI

    Sibyl includes storytelling, image generation, and face swap features to spark creativity with esoteric themes.

  • Enterprise AI builder training models for document understanding
    Pick: Surge AI

    Surge offers GDP.pdf benchmark and expert labeling for complex real-world PDF tasks, plus RL environments like EnterpriseBench.

  • Budget-limited individual experimenting with AI for spiritual guidance
    Pick: Sibyl AI

    Sibyl's $29/mo tier is affordable for personal use, though no free tier exists. Surge's custom pricing is prohibitive.

Can Sibyl AI help with general productivity tasks?

It has GPT-4o general task support but is primarily focused on metaphysical and creative applications, not general productivity.

Does Surge AI offer pre-built models?

No, Surge is a human feedback platform, not a model provider. It helps train and evaluate your own models via expert labor.

Is Sibyl AI suitable for skeptics of esoteric concepts?

No, its features like dream interpretation and Ennealogy assume belief in occult traditions. Skeptics may find it pseudoscientific.

What benchmarks does Surge AI offer?

Antidote, Riemann-bench, GDP.pdf, ComplexConstraints, Hemingway-bench, and EnterpriseBench, as per latest news.

Does Sibyl AI have an API for integration?

The provided information does not mention an API; it appears to be a consumer app with web interface.

What is the pricing for Surge AI?

It is contact-based; no public pricing. Typically paid per expert hour or project, likely expensive.

Can I use Surge AI for simple sentiment analysis?

It's not recommended; Surge is optimized for complex, reasoning-intensive tasks. Simpler tasks may be overkill and costly.

Does Sibyl AI offer a free trial?

No free tier is mentioned; only paid plans starting at $29/mo.
